Family Counseling

In family therapy, the Therapist views the family as the primary unit of focus and the interactions of the individuals as key. The Therapist will utilize an integrative, multi-system, multi-method approach to treat the family and the key components ( family members) to address the dynamics and maladaptive patterns within the family unit.

The Therapist will provide comprehensive, strength based approaches to address some of the challenges families face to include: Co- parenting, divorce , Substance abuse, death of a loved one, blended families, medical issues, sexual abuse as an adult or child, sexual assault of a family member, domestic violence, parent- child relational issues, suppressed memories of trauma etc.

Length of Session: Family sessions are typically 60-90 minutes.

Couples Counseling

In couples counseling, the Therapist views the relationship as the primary unit of focus and the interactions of the individuals as key. The Therapist will meet with the couple to address issues within their relationship, develop goals for healthier interactions and improve the overall dynamics/ functioning of the relationship. The couple will rebuild a relationship with improved communication, trust, empathy and connection.

The Therapist will use an integrative approach to couples counseling, using methods of Gottman Therapy, Solution Focused Therapy and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y.

Length of Session: Couple sessions are typically 60-90 minutes.
